Warren Elliott Obituary

Published by Legacy Remembers on Nov. 10, 2025.
Warren Ray Elliott, 75, of Hickory Flat (Lake Arrowhead) passed away at Flowers Hospital in Dothan, Alabama, on October 29, 2025, after an extended illness.

He was born on June 25, 1950 to Rev. O. Lex Elliott and Elizabeth Roebke Elliott.

He was a graduate of Myrtle High School, attended Northeast Community College in Booneville and served in the National Guard.

Warren worked for AT&T in Memphis and retired there in fiber optics. One of his most rewarding endeavors was the twenty plus years associated with the Boy Scouts. He was on the Wood Badge staff as Scout Master, 4th Bead and NJLIC Scout Master. After returning to Union County, he worked at O'Reilly Auto Parts, Gardaworld and was a volunteer with Myrtle Fire Department.

Warren is survived by his wife, Debra Fitzpatrick Elliott, two sons, Gregory Elliott of Hickory Flat and Chris Elliott (Peige) of Collierville, TN; one sister, Mary Helen Waggoner (Spencer) of Columbus, MS. His grandsons are Michael Elliott, Landon Elliott and Luke Elliott. He also leaves several nieces and nephews.

He is also survived by his step-children, Brandy Kimbrough (Gene) of Houston, MS; Eric Martin of Pontotoc, MS; Kelly McRaney (Bobby) of Wheeler, MS. Step-grandchildren are Brooklyn Thomas (Charlie) and children Rivers, Dovey and Woods; Presley Byars; Colton Byars (Diamond) and children Holden and Callie.

Warren was preceded in death by his parents and youngest son Tony Elliott.

A Celebration of Life will be held on Saturday, November 15, 2025 at Myrtle First Church in Myrtle, MS, where Warren was a member. Visitation will begin at 11 a.m., with service to follow at 12 noon.
